Output 7820f94f9bc180cfc200325408d092e8c677a5d964c826b69e78ea60d1dcdf13:3

value
1700000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bd7b35092d7dd7e41a9b17ec626c6fbfbb650ad OP_EQUALVERIFY OP_CHECKSIG
address
16TRGSyfQ15cZsGAbbtqNfFHsj8vxGFDwo
transaction
7820f94f9bc180cfc200325408d092e8c677a5d964c826b69e78ea60d1dcdf13
spent
true